What companies run services between Japan and Mostar, Bosnia and Herzegovina?

There is no direct connection from Japan to Mostar. However, you can take the subway to Fukuoka Airport, walk to Fukuoka Airport (FUK) airport, fly to Sarajevo (SJJ), walk to Sarajevo Airport, take the line 36 bus to Neđarići, walk to Sarajevo - Neđarići, take the line 5 vehicle to Sarajevo Uni Campus, walk to Sarajevo, then take the train to Mostar. Alternatively, you can take the train to Hamamatsuchō, walk to Monorail Hamamatsuchō, take the train to Haneda Airport Terminal 1, walk to Tokyo International Airport (HND) airport, fly to Sarajevo (SJJ), walk to Sarajevo Airport, take the line 36 bus to Neđarići, walk to Sarajevo - Neđarići, take the line 5 vehicle to Sarajevo Uni Campus, walk to Sarajevo, then take the train to Mostar.
